GoAir to start vaccination drive for all employees

Low-cost carrier GoAir said on Wednesday that it will commence a programme to get its entire workforce vaccinated free of cost.

Accordingly, GoAir has tied up with various hospitals in different cities for the vaccination programme.

"The airline will pay the cost for both dozes of vaccination," it said.

Besides, GoAir has planned to allow vaccinated employees to take two days' leave over and above the entitled threshold.

At present, the airline has 4,481 employees in its workforce, who will get vaccinated.
